WHAT IS AGREEMENT? WHY TO BECOME A CONTACT AN AGREEMENT
MUST BE ENFORCEBLE BY LAW?
Answer / sathya narayanan k
As per Contract Act, an agreement enforceable by law is a
contract. [section 2(h)]. Hence, we have to understand first
what is ‘agreement’?
Every promise and every set of promises, forming the
consideration for each other, is an agreement. [section 2(e)]
